- Q4 volumes down 4% year-over-year, total revenue down 2% for the quarter.
- Adjusted Q4 operating ratio was 65.3; GAAP EPS for the quarter was $3.22.
- Free cash flow for 2025 was $2.2 billion, the highest conversion since 2021, and full-year bottom line grew 5% YoY after a favorable state tax resolution.

- Sanofi reported full year 2025 sales of EUR 43.6 billion, up 9.9% at constant exchange rates, with Q4 sales EUR 11.3 billion, up 13.3%.
- Dupixent remains the growth engine, delivering EUR 4.2 billion in Q4 and EUR 15.7 billion for the year, with expansion into new indications including COPD and CSU driving strong volume uptake.
- New launches and vaccines accelerated, with newly launched medicines and vaccines growing 34% in 2025 and ALTUVIIIO reaching blockbuster status at EUR 1.2 billion full-year sales.

- Record backlog at $194 billion, about 2.5 times annual sales, the largest in company history and fourth consecutive year of backlog growth.
- Full-year 2025 sales were $75.0 billion, up 6% year-over-year, driven by Missiles and Fire Control, Aeronautics, and Space.
- Lockheed generated $6.9 billion of free cash flow in 2025, after pre-funding the pension with roughly $860 million and reinvesting $3.6 billion back into the business.

- Total company revenue grew 1% in Q4 2025, with Comcast’s six growth businesses representing ~60% of revenue and growing mid-single digits.
- Adjusted EBITDA declined 10% in the quarter and adjusted EPS fell 12%, reflecting strategic reinvestment and new sports rights costs.
- Full-year 2025 free cash flow was a record $19.2 billion, helped by lumpy tax timing and working capital benefits; Q4 free cash flow was $4.4 billion and included about $2 billion of a cash tax benefit from an internal reorganization.

- Record full-year sales and revenues of $67.6 billion in 2025, the highest in company history.
- Fourth quarter sales and revenues hit an all-time quarterly record of $19.1 billion, +18% year-over-year, driven by stronger-than-expected volume in power and energy.
- Backlog surged to a record $51 billion, up $21 billion or 71% year-over-year, with roughly 62% of backlog expected to deliver in the next 12 months.
